# 如何平衡监控深度与网络性能?
## 引言
在现代网络安全领域,监控深度与网络性能之间的平衡是一个复杂而关键的问题。随着网络攻击手段的不断升级,深度监控成为保障网络安全的重要手段。然而,过度的监控又会消耗大量网络资源,影响网络性能。如何在保障网络安全的同时,不牺牲网络性能,成为业界亟待解决的问题。本文将探讨这一主题,并结合AI技术在网络安全监控中的应用,提出相应的解决方案。
## 一、监控深度与网络性能的矛盾
### 1.1 监控深度的必要性
网络安全监控的深度直接影响着对潜在威胁的识别和响应能力。深度监控包括但不限于:
- **数据包分析**:对网络数据包进行深度解析,识别恶意代码和异常行为。
- **行为分析**:通过分析用户和系统的行为模式,发现异常活动。
- **日志分析**:收集和分析系统日志,追踪潜在的安全事件。
这些深度监控手段能够有效提升网络安全的防护能力,但同时也带来了巨大的数据处理需求。
### 1.2 网络性能的影响
深度监控对网络性能的影响主要体现在以下几个方面:
- **带宽消耗**:大量数据包的捕获和分析会占用大量带宽。
- **计算资源消耗**:深度分析需要高性能的计算资源,可能导致系统响应变慢。
- **延迟增加**:数据处理和分析过程会增加网络延迟,影响用户体验。
### 1.3 矛盾的根源
监控深度与网络性能的矛盾根源在于资源有限性与安全需求无限性之间的冲突。如何在有限的资源条件下,实现高效的网络安全监控,是一个亟待解决的问题。
## 二、AI技术在网络安全监控中的应用
### 2.1 AI技术的优势
AI技术在网络安全监控中的应用,能够有效缓解监控深度与网络性能之间的矛盾。其优势主要体现在:
- **高效数据处理**:AI算法能够快速处理和分析大量数据,提高监控效率。
- **智能识别**:通过机器学习和深度学习技术,AI能够识别复杂的攻击模式和行为异常。
- **自适应优化**:AI系统能够根据网络环境的变化,自适应调整监控策略,优化资源分配。
### 2.2 应用场景
#### 2.2.1 数据包智能分析
利用AI技术对数据包进行智能分析,可以快速识别恶意代码和异常行为。具体应用包括:
- **深度包检测(DPI)**:通过AI算法对数据包内容进行深度解析,识别潜在的威胁。
- **流量分类**:基于机器学习算法,对网络流量进行分类,识别异常流量。
#### 2.2.2 行为模式识别
AI技术能够通过对用户和系统行为的分析,识别异常模式。具体应用包括:
- **用户行为分析(UBA)**:通过机器学习算法,分析用户行为模式,发现异常活动。
- **系统行为监控**:利用AI技术监控系统行为,识别潜在的攻击行为。
#### 2.2.3 日志智能分析
AI技术在日志分析中的应用,能够提高日志处理的效率和准确性。具体应用包括:
- **日志聚类**:通过聚类算法,对日志数据进行分类,识别异常日志。
- **异常检测**:利用机器学习算法,检测日志中的异常事件。
## 三、平衡监控深度与网络性能的策略
### 3.1 动态监控策略
#### 3.1.1 自适应监控
基于AI技术的自适应监控策略,能够根据网络环境的变化,动态调整监控深度。具体措施包括:
- **实时流量分析**:通过实时分析网络流量,动态调整数据包分析的深度。
- **行为模式动态识别**:根据用户和系统的实时行为,动态调整行为分析的深度。
#### 3.1.2 资源优先级分配
根据网络资源的实时状态,动态分配监控资源的优先级。具体措施包括:
- **带宽优先级分配**:在高带宽需求时段,降低数据包分析的深度,保障网络性能。
- **计算资源动态分配**:根据计算资源的实时负载,动态调整监控任务的优先级。
### 3.2 智能优化算法
#### 3.2.1 机器学习优化
利用机器学习算法,优化监控策略,提高监控效率。具体措施包括:
- **特征选择**:通过机器学习算法,选择最具代表性的特征,减少数据处理量。
- **模型优化**:优化机器学习模型,提高识别准确率,减少误报率。
#### 3.2.2 深度学习应用
利用深度学习技术,提高监控的智能化水平。具体措施包括:
- **深度神经网络**:构建深度神经网络模型,提高异常行为的识别能力。
- **强化学习**:通过强化学习算法,优化监控策略,提高资源利用效率。
### 3.3 分布式监控架构
#### 3.3.1 分布式数据处理
采用分布式架构,分散数据处理压力,提高监控效率。具体措施包括:
- **分布式数据采集**:在不同节点分布式采集数据,减少单点压力。
- **分布式数据分析**:在不同节点分布式进行数据分析,提高处理效率。
#### 3.3.2 边缘计算应用
利用边缘计算技术,将部分监控任务迁移到网络边缘,减少中心节点的负载。具体措施包括:
- **边缘节点监控**:在边缘节点进行初步监控,过滤掉大量正常数据,减少中心节点的处理压力。
- **边缘智能分析**:在边缘节点进行初步智能分析,识别部分异常行为,减轻中心节点的计算负担。
## 四、案例分析
### 4.1 案例一:某大型企业的网络安全监控
#### 4.1.1 背景介绍
某大型企业面临复杂的网络安全威胁,需要深度监控网络活动,但同时又不能影响企业的正常运营。
#### 4.1.2 解决方案
- **动态监控策略**:采用自适应监控策略,根据网络流量的实时变化,动态调整监控深度。
- **AI技术应用**:利用机器学习和深度学习技术,提高数据包分析和行为识别的效率。
- **分布式架构**:采用分布式监控架构,分散数据处理压力,提高监控效率。
#### 4.1.3 效果评估
通过实施上述方案,该企业在保障网络安全的同时,网络性能得到了有效保障,用户体验未受影响。
### 4.2 案例二:某云计算平台的网络安全监控
#### 4.2.1 背景介绍
某云计算平台需要对其庞大的网络环境进行深度监控,但同时又不能影响云服务的性能。
#### 4.2.2 解决方案
- **智能优化算法**:利用机器学习和深度学习算法,优化监控策略,提高监控效率。
- **边缘计算应用**:在边缘节点进行初步监控和智能分析,减轻中心节点的负载。
- **资源优先级分配**:根据资源实时状态,动态分配监控资源的优先级。
#### 4.2.3 效果评估
通过实施上述方案,该云计算平台在保障网络安全的同时,云服务的性能得到了有效保障,用户满意度提升。
## 五、未来展望
### 5.1 技术发展趋势
随着AI技术的不断进步,网络安全监控将更加智能化和高效化。未来技术发展趋势包括:
- **更高效的AI算法**:研发更高效的机器学习和深度学习算法,提高监控效率。
- **更智能的监控策略**:基于AI技术的自适应监控策略,将更加智能化和动态化。
- **更强大的分布式架构**:分布式监控架构将更加完善,数据处理能力将大幅提升。
### 5.2 应用前景
AI技术在网络安全监控中的应用前景广阔,具体包括:
- **智能防御系统**:基于AI技术的智能防御系统,将能够实时识别和响应各种网络安全威胁。
- **自动化运维**:AI技术将推动网络安全监控的自动化运维,提高运维效率。
- **跨域协同监控**:基于AI技术的跨域协同监控,将能够实现不同网络环境下的协同防御。
## 结论
平衡监控深度与网络性能是网络安全领域的重要课题。通过结合AI技术,采用动态监控策略、智能优化算法和分布式监控架构,可以有效缓解这一矛盾,实现高效的网络监控。未来,随着AI技术的不断进步,网络安全监控将更加智能化和高效化,为网络安全提供更强大的保障。